Designing Lovable from the ground up has been the greatest privilege of my career.
Today we announced our $330M Series B at a $6.6B valuation.
First: thank you to the millions of people building with Lovable.
When we started, we knew AI would eventually write most of the world's code. We also knew the most meaningful thing we could do was put that power in everyone's hands—not just the 1% who could code before.
For decades, software has been eating the world. But the ability to create it was locked behind years of learning syntax and frameworks. The barrier to build is gone now.
This round lets us continue what we've always done—invest in the best team to make the best product possible.
